Description Jameer Pathan 2021-08-12 06:59:56 UTC
Description of problem:
"NoMethodError: undefined method `id' for nil:NilClass" error while creating a repository in a new organization and location.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
- Satellite 6.10.0 snap 12

How reproducible:
-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Create Organization
2. Create location, and add organization to it.
3. Create product
4. Try creating a repository.

Actual results:
- "Task f151931f-f32f-4bd8-ba1d-138bc9913489: NoMethodError: undefined method `id' for nil:NilClass" error is shown.

Expected results:
- No error while creating a repository.

Additional info:
- I can see that the repository is created despite of the error shown.
